  • Processor (CPU): Intel Celeron M540 1.86 GHz
  • Memory (RAM): 1GB DDR2-667MHz (Max Memory 2 GB)
  • Hard Drive: 120GB S-ATA 5400RPM
  • Screen: 15.4" Widescreen TFT (1280x800) with CrystalBrite Technology
  • Optical Drive: DVD±RW Dual Layer
  • Graphics: SiS Mirage 3+ Graphics, 64 MB shared memory
  • Wireless Networking: 802.11b/g
  • Wired Networking: 10/100
  • Operating System: Windows Vista Home Basic
  • Card Reader: N/A
  • USB Ports: 3
  • Firewire: No
  • Bluetooth: No
  • Camera: No
  • Weight: 2.7Kg
  • Warranty: 1 Year Collect and Return

30-Apr-2008 Carl: If i have a ADSL broadband Router, would this laptop find it (use the internet) without using the USB dongle?

Easycom: The USB dongle is for bluetooth connectivity (e.g. to a mobile phone or similar mobile device). To connect to the router you would use the integrated wireless network adapter. You may need to connect it to the router with a standard network cable to set it up initially dependant on the existing configuration

25-Mar-2008 maura duffin: we have bought thsi product but cannot get it to go online. apparently there is a button to press (where?) the one tha might be a button won't budge. we received no handbook with this p.c. and would have been lost unless we had computer knowledge. is there a shortcut to enable us to use the internet? help!! please

Easycom: I believe you hold down the Function key and press F1 to turn the wireless on, and do it again to turn it off. The function key should say 'Func' or 'Fn' on it.

25-Mar-2008 mrs collins: Does this product come with an installed modem? If not, where do I get one from? I have an Orange Live Box - Does that mean I can hook it up to the laptop and it will go online, or do I need to buy a modem to install on the laptop? Please advise! thanks

Easycom: The Orange LiveBox is a modem in itself - This laptop has a network socket to connect to your LiveBox via a wire, it also has integrated wireless - which means if your LiveBox supports wireless networking, then you will be able to connect this laptop to it without a wire.

25-Mar-2008 keith lightbown: can i use this laptop on a dail up connection abroad , if i need any accessories what are they please

Easycom: This laptop does not have a dial-up modem integrated. Ideally you should buy a laptop with an integrated 56k modem such as the Dell Inspiron 6400. Alternatively you can buy an external USB 56K modem.
